UiO‐66 metal–organic frameworks in biomedicine: From structural tunability to bioimaging, photodiagnostics, and photodynamic cancer therapy

open access: yesFEBS Open Bio, EarlyView.
UiO‐66(Zr) metal–organic frameworks are chemically stable, biocompatible, and highly tunable nanomaterials. Their modular structure enables controlled drug delivery, multimodal bioimaging, and light‐activated photodynamic therapy, supporting integrated diagnostic and therapeutic (theranostic) applications in cancer and biomedical research.

From energy provision to protein synthesis: Tunnelling nanotubes as mediators of intercellular metabolic cooperation in cancer

open access: yesFEBS Open Bio, EarlyView.
The cytoskeleton‐mediated transport of mitochondria via tunnelling nanotubes restores respiration, increases ATP production, rescues cells from apoptosis, activates the AKT/mTOR signalling pathway, promotes cell migration and invasiveness, contributes to cancer progression and treatment resistance.

Transient Coma and Signs of Encephalopathy Related to 5-Fluorouracil and Carboplatin: A Case Report

open access: yesCase Reports in Oncology, 2023
Chemotherapy-related encephalopathy is a rare but severe side effect of cancer therapy. Few reports exist on the course of encephalopathy due to 5-fluorouracil (5FU)/carboplatin treatment.

A Spatially Directed Microneedle Patch Enables Intratumoral Co‐Delivery of FOLFIRINOX, Surufatinib, and Anti‐PD‐1 for Chemo‐Immunotherapy of Pancreatic Ductal Adenocarcinoma

open access: yesAdvanced Science, EarlyView.
A double‐layered shell‐core microneedle patch is developed to co‐deliver FOLFIRINOX, surufatinib, and anti‐PD‐1 for localized chemo‐immunotherapy of PDAC.
